How Does It Work?

This calculator allows you to choose between two input methods: using full room dimensions or specifying individual walls. Based on your entries, it computes the total area to be covered and subtracts the space taken by windows and doors. It then calculates how many drywall sheets you’ll need, including an optional waste factor for offcuts and mistakes.

Formulas Used:
  • Total Wall Area = (Perimeter × Height) + Ceiling (optional)
  • Drywallable Area = Total Wall Area − (Doors Area + Windows Area)
  • Adjusted Area = Drywallable Area × Waste Factor
  • Sheets Needed = Adjusted Area ÷ Sheet Size (rounded up)

How is the waste factor used?

The waste factor compensates for mistakes, cuts, and unusable offcuts. For standard rooms, 10% is generally recommended.
